2. Prohibited Activities
The following activities are strictly prohibited on AutoSter:
Fake or Fraudulent Listings
- Listing vehicles you do not own or have no legal right to sell.
- Posting listings with intentionally false or misleading information.
- Using stolen or fabricated vehicle images.
- Listing vehicles at artificially low prices to attract buyers (bait-and-switch).
- Creating multiple accounts to post duplicate listings.
Fraud and Scams
- Requesting payment via untraceable methods (wire transfer, cryptocurrency, gift cards).
- Attempting to collect deposits or advance fees for vehicles that do not exist.
- Impersonating AutoSter staff, DVLA officials, or other authorities.
- Phishing for personal or financial information from other users.
- Any form of advance-fee fraud or overpayment scam.
Illegal Vehicle Sales
- Listing stolen vehicles or vehicles with cloned identities.
- Selling Category A or Category B write-off vehicles without explicit disclosure.
- Listing vehicles with outstanding finance without disclosing it to buyers.
- Selling vehicles subject to a logbook loan without disclosure.
- Any vehicle sale that violates UK consumer protection laws.
